Deborah LaMarche Telehealth Excellence Award
The Deborah LaMarche Telehealth Excellence Award is presented annually to an individual or organization in Utah that has accomplished outstanding work in the field of telehealth, including the areas of policy development, innovative programs and activities, technology, patient and or provider support, education, and training.
The first award was given to Deborah LaMarche upon her retirement in June 2020, for her approximately 25 years of tireless service in assisting individuals and organizations in Utah, and across the nation, in developing successful telehealth programs.
